A leading plant hire and haulage company in Winsley is seeking a Setting Out Engineer for a temporary full-time role. The position involves conducting OGL surveys, monitoring project progress, and ensuring compliance with health and safety requirements.
Candidates should have proficiency in surveying and AutoCAD, along with relevant civil engineering qualifications. This family-run business values reliability and offers opportunities for ongoing development and career growth.
